Rum Bottle NFTs

Ron Carúpano Turned Rum Bottle Designs into Digital Assets

Venezuelan brand Ron Carúpano is exploring Art, Innovation and Rum with a project that turns rum bottle designs into works of art. Created in collaboration with five artists, the project features the brand's Legendario expression, which can now be owned as a digital asset. The NFTs spotlight each Venezuelan artist's unique perspective and style, and the designs can now be found in the OpenSea marketplace.

Profits from the innovative NFT project from Ron Carúpano and artists Armando Velutini, Aureliano Parra, Gerardo Campos, Dagor and Carlos Vallenilla will help to support the Thomas Merle Foundation in Carúpano, Venezuela, which is the same place where the rum producer’s ageing facilities can be found. The unique art pieces celebrate artistry, feed back into the local community and help to provide collectors with authenticated goods that they can keep or trade.
